About the Project:
The Colorado Department of Transportation and contract partner Work Zone Traffic Control will begin a sign replacement
project on Colorado Highway 83 mid January 2023. New signs will be installed along CO 83 from Mile Point 30.2, El Paso
County line, to MP 53.9, Bayou Gulch.
Work will include the removal of 317 worn out signs, installation of 349 new signs and installation of new sign posts. The new
signs will consist of speed limit, directional, street, mile point, guide, regulatory, warning signs and flashing beacons. The
new signs will have better reflectivity at night to help motorists navigate the highway safely.
